空间碎片的温度特性分析
引用本文:王国培,何永强,王 群.空间碎片的温度特性分析[J].航天器环境工程,2012,29(6):645-649.
作者姓名:王国培  何永强  王 群
作者单位:军械工程学院光学与电子工程系,石家庄,050003
摘    要:对空间碎片温度特性的分析,是利用红外传感器探测空间碎片的基础,也是研究航天器在轨安全的重要内容.文章对空间碎片接收不同辐射进行全面分析,研究其在轨运行情况,建立热平衡方程,完成对不同时刻其温度变化的计算,并绘制出温度变化曲线.结果表明空间碎片在轨道上不同位置有不同的红外辐射特性.该研究对利用天基空间探测器进行空间碎片的检测、识别,以及航天器的规避有参考意义.

关 键 词:空间碎片  黑体辐射  热平衡  温度特性

Analysis of the temperature characteristics of space debris
Wang Guopei,He Yongqiang and Wang Qun.Analysis of the temperature characteristics of space debris[J].Spacecraft Environment Engineering,2012,29(6):645-649.
Authors:Wang Guopei  He Yongqiang and Wang Qun
Institution:(Department of Optical and Electronic Engineering,Ordnance Engineering College,Shijiazhuang 050003,China)
Abstract:Analysis of the temperature characteristics of space debris is the basis of infrared sensors to detect the space debris, and an important part of the safety study of the spacecraft in orbit. A quantitative analysis of the radiation from space debris is carried out, to study its in-orbit operation. The temperature at different instants is calculated, complete with the temperature vs. time curve. The results show different characteristics at different locations of space debris in orbit. Analysis of the infrared radiation characteristics is important for the space debris detection and identification with space-based probes and for the spacecraft's aversion.
Keywords:space debris  blackbody radiation  thermal balance  temperature characteristics
